Garage footing installation involves setting a concrete foundation beneath a garage or similar structure to provide stability and support. This process typically includes excavating the area, preparing a solid base, and pouring reinforced concrete footings that help distribute the weight of the garage evenly across the ground. Proper installation ensures that the structure remains level and secure over time, preventing issues related to shifting or settling. Service providers experienced in this work can assess the specific needs of a property and install footings that meet local soil and ground conditions, helping to create a durable foundation for the garage.

One of the main problems that garage footing installation helps address is ground movement, which can cause structural instability. In areas like Rockledge, FL, where soil types can vary and moisture levels fluctuate, improperly supported garages may develop cracks, uneven floors, or even settle unevenly. Installing a proper footing acts as a safeguard against these issues by providing a stable base that resists shifting and settling. This service is especially valuable for homeowners who notice existing cracks or unevenness in their garage floors or are planning to build a new garage that requires a solid foundation.

Garage footing installation is often needed for properties that have experienced soil erosion, poor drainage, or previous ground shifting. It is also common for homes with uneven terrain or those built on expansive soils that tend to swell and shrink with moisture changes. Commercial properties or homes with large garages that support heavy vehicles or equipment may also benefit from reinforced footings to ensure long-term stability. Service providers can evaluate the site conditions and recommend the appropriate footing design to prevent future problems related to ground movement or structural failure.

The overview below groups typical Garage Footing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Rockledge, FL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or garage footing repairs in Rockledge, FL, range from $250 to $600, covering tasks like crack filling or small reinforcement projects.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the scope of work and materials needed.

Standard Installations - Installing new garage footings or replacing existing ones us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000 for most local projects. Larger, more complex installations can reach $4,000 or more, though fewer projects fall into this highest tier.

Full Replacement - Complete garage footing replacements in the area typically range from $3,500 to $8,000, depending on the size of the garage and site conditions. Many projects in this category are mid-sized, with larger jobs being less common.

Custom or Complex Projects - Custom footing solutions or projects involving additional structural work can exceed $10,000, but these are less frequent. Local contractors can provide detailed estimates based on specific project requ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is the purpose of garage footing installation? Garage footing installation provides a stable foundation that helps prevent settling and structural issues in garage constructions or upgrades.

How do local contractors typically install garage footings? Contractors usually excavate the area, pour concrete footings with proper reinforcement, and ensure level placement to support the garage structure effectively.

What materials are used for garage footings? The most common material for garage footings is concrete, often reinforced with steel rebar to increase strength and durability.

Why is proper footing installation important for garages? Proper footing installation ensures the garage remains stable over time, reducing the risk of cracks, uneven settling, or other structural problems.
